Public Art – Courtyard

The Pelham Art Center is accepting proposals for temporary public solo and group exhibitions / installations to be installed in our 2,300sq.ft. open court yard. Work should be able to stay on site for three months and should activate the entire courtyard while considering the scale, architecture and use of the courtyard. We strongly encourage site-specific proposals. Proposals will be selected by our Gallery Advisory Committee on the basis of creativity, interactivity, structural integrity and sustainability.

* Creativity/interactivity: Your work should be visually engaging and invite viewers of all ages to enter the court yard to experience the work further.

* Structural Integrity: Your work must be able to withstand three months of exposure to New York weather as well as unsupervised interaction from passers-by and visitors to the Art Center day and night.

Receiving and Removal of Work: The artist will be responsible for transporting their work to and from the Art Center.

Installation: The artist will be responsible for installing and de-installing their artwork. Pelham Art Center will assist the artist as needed.

Publicity: Pelham Art Center will publicize the installation of the work through our regular notices and stories to local media outlets, our email database of 5000 as well as on our website (www.pelhamartcenter.org.) Pelham Art Center is located on Pelham’s main commercial street, with constant foot and car traffic passing by. The courtyard is used frequently by passersby and we can assure a constant flow of traffic and many eyes on the work.

Stipend: Pelham Art Center does provide a artist stipend, with this we also expect at least one educational community engagement.

Timeline: Applications will be accepted on a rolling basis.
